I don't exactly know about the Hannomag's figures, but what I can say is that certain FOV vehicles, even when the same type, can come with variable amounts of figures. Most vehicles have one, but a select few come with two, for example the Panzer IV F (short barreled) and the new winterized T-34. The Normandy Hannomag probably only does come with one figure.
The troops used in the Build-a-Rama diorama may be K&C figures as they certainly are not 21c or FOV 1:32 scale figures.

Please note that this repainted vehicle will come with 4 crew members........... but not the Russian Front version. We have specially sculpted 4 figures in Normandy uniforms with new poses for this vehicle, which look very attractive to me.
